How Xanthan Gum Is Produced (In Simple Terms)
Through fermentation, Xanthan gum is produced. A bacterium that naturally occurs, Xanthomonas campestris, ferments natural and sugar carbohydrates like glucose or sucrose. The resulting polysaccharide is purified, dried, and milled into a fine powder.
For manufacturers, the significance lies in consistency. Fermentation-based production guarantees that xanthan gum gives the same viscosity and binding properties throughout different batches. A primary requirement for large-scale food manufacturing in Australia.
Why Xanthan Gum is Used in Gluten-Free Production
Gluten is responsible for the dough’s properties of elasticity, strength, moisture retention, and flexibility. When wheat is removed, food systems lose their natural binding network. Xanthan gum takes over the loss by producing a viscous gel when hydrated, creating cohesion between starches, proteins, and fats.
Xanthan gum is utilised in gluten-free breads, cakes, and pastries for the following:
- Eliminates crumbling and falling
- Makes the handling of the dough easier in mixing and shaping
- Brings out the crumb structure and elasticity more
- Makes the product last longer by retaining the moisture
Food Standards Australia New Zealand (FSANZ) has approved xanthan gum (INS 415) for use in food manufacturing within regulated limits, making it a compliant and trusted additive for Australian processors.
Functional Benefits in Vegan Food Manufacturing
Vegan formulations face similar challenges to gluten-free products: the loss of eggs, dairy proteins, and gelatin means less structure and less emulsification. Xanthan gum Australia is the one that plays the dual role here. It works as both a binder and a stabiliser at the same time.
In the production of plant-based foods, the enzyme plays an important role in:
- Stability of dairy-free sauces and dressings emulsions
- Thickness of non-dairy plant drinks
- Uniformity of the texture of eggless baked goods
- Stability of vegan desserts during freeze-thaw cycles

Usage Levels in Commercial Food Manufacturing
Xanthan gum is very efficient even at the minimum levels, which makes it an economical purchase for the manufacturers.
Standard usage rates are:
- Gluten-free bread: 0.3%–0.8% of flour weight
- Cakes and muffins: 0.2%–0.5%
- Vegan sauces and dressings: 0.1%–0.4%
- Plant-based beverages: 0.05%–0.2%
The use of excessive xanthan gum may lead to products with very thick or sticky textures. You need to use a careful formulation, especially in gluten-free baking processes.
Xanthan Gum vs Natural Binders in Manufacturing
Artisan baking can effectively use natural binders like chia, flaxseed, and psyllium, but their large-scale application has the following downsides:
- Hydration is not uniform
- Shelf life is shorter
- Flavour or colour impact is stronger
On the contrary, xanthan gum provides manufacturers with:
- Taste and appearance neutral
- Long shelf life
- Predictability in performance in automated systems
